Multi-party delegation in London
The London go to is a part of a broader diplomatic outreach launched by the Indian authorities following Operation Sindoor – a navy response to the April 22 Pahalgam terror assault that killed 26 folks.
The operation, initiated on May 7, focused terror infrastructure in Pakistan and Pakistan-occupied Jammu and Kashmir, killing over 100 terrorists related to teams like Jaish-e-Mohammed, Lashkar-e-Taiba, and Hizbul Mujahideen.
The Indian delegation, led by senior BJP chief and former Union Minister Ravi Shankar Prasad, consists of parliamentarians from numerous events: Daggubati Purandeswari (TDP), Priyanka Chaturvedi (Shiv Sena-UBT), Ghulam Ali Khatana (BJP), Dr. Amar Singh (Congress), Samik Bhattacharya (BJP), former Union Minister MJ Akbar, and Ambassador Pankaj Saran. The workforce arrived in London on Saturday after visiting France, Italy, and Denmark.

This go to is a part of seven deliberate worldwide excursions involving round 40 multi-party parliamentarians, marking the primary time the Indian authorities is deputing MPs from throughout get together traces to current India’s place on Kashmir and cross-border terrorism.
The intention is to bolster India’s zero-tolerance stance on terrorism and expose Pakistan’s terror networks globally
